Hepatitis E virus genes have been identified in pigmeat products in several countries, including Ireland, according to the Food Safety Authority of Ireland (FSAI). This week, the FSAI published a report by its Scientific Committee on hepatitis E virus in pigs and pigmeat in Ireland. The report is a scientific review examining the occurrence, transmission, and potential mitigation strategies for the public health aspects of the hepatitis E virus within Ireland’s pig farms and pigmeat […]

What Is Soil pH? Soil pH is a measurement of soil acidity or alkalinity on a scale of 0 to 14. Most crops grow best between pH 6.0 and 7.0 because nutrients remain readily available to plant roots in that range. If crops are not responding to fertilizer, poor soil pH is usually the first […]
